The Merit-based Incentive Payment System (MIPS) scores providers 0–100 across four performance categories: Quality, Cost, Promoting Interoperability, and Improvement Activities, weighted under 42 CFR §414.1380. Reporting is voluntary for many small practices, so absence of a MIPS score is not a quality signal.

Board certification through an ABMS or AOA member board signals voluntary post-licensure examination plus continuous Maintenance of Certification cycles. Verify any individual provider's status through certificationmatters.org (ABMS) or osteopathic.org (AOA).

Amin Kazemi, D.M.D., M.D. appears in the CMS NPPES registry as a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ery (Dentist) provider holding D.M.D., M.D. credentials at 600 E MARSHALL ST STE 106, West Chester, PA, 19380, with a listed phone of (610) 431-2161. NPI 1720124746 was issued on 01/29/2007. Because NPPES data is self-reported by the provider and refreshed monthly, the address, phone, and specialty reflect what Kazemi most recently submitted to CMS rather than a vetted directory listing, which is why patients should always confirm the practice is still at this location before scheduling.

Medicare Part D records for calendar year 2023 show 479 prescription claims written by this provider, covering 199 Medicare beneficiaries and totaling roughly $2K in drug spend, with an opioid prescribing rate of 6.9%. These figures capture only Medicare Part D, commercial insurance, Medicaid, and cash-pay prescriptions are not included, and any drug-beneficiary cell under 11 is suppressed by CMS for patient privacy.

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ery (Dentist) is a mid-sized specialty nationwide, with 7,631 enrolled providers across 52 states and an average of 378 Part D claims per prescriber, so the context for interpreting these metrics differs meaningfully from a primary-care baseline. The federal Physician Payments Sunshine Act (part of the Affordable Care Act) requires drug and medical-device manufacturers + group purchasing organizations to publicly report payments and other transfers of value to physicians and teaching hospitals. Industry payments are not necessarily indicators of bias, they include research funding, consulting fees for evidence-based work, royalties for inventions, food at conferences, and similar items. The disclosure exists for transparency. Read our methodology for how we interpret this data.
